Answers telephones promptly, and handles/screens calls courteously, professionally, and appropriately, including scheduling of patient appointments as directed and taking messages. Assists call center operators as needed. (5%) Completes outreach activities as assigned. (10%) Promotes and assists patients to use the patient portal. (10%) Schedules patients for In-House procedures and assists with initiation of referrals to outside agencies/providers. Assists with tracking process per protocol. (5%) Updates EHR and maintains accurate clinical data with incoming medical reports. Sends appropriate reports to be scanned. Performs follow-up functions as assigned. (15%) Coordinates new patient appointments. Prepares electronic health record with accurate medication lists, patient histories and other pertinent information prior to the patient appointment. Inputs data into the computer in accordance with GLBHC protocol. (15%) Informs patients of lab and diagnostic test results as delegated by provider per Policy CLIN. 79. Provides limited patient education as directed by the provider or team leader. Processes clinical forms as appropriate. (25%) Maintain desktops and assists as delegated by Center Manager/Primary Care Coordinator.
